The complex consists of two wood-framed, 4-storey residential low-rise buildings seated on a common single level underground parkade.
Williams Engineering (WE) provided the building envelope consulting engineering services during the construction of the Carrington Multifamily project. Our building envelope and roofing design services included a review of the building envelope and roofing detail drawings provided by the architect.
WE provided recommendations regarding the building envelope systems and details. This included building envelope site reviews during construction, with special attention being paid to the detailing of the air barrier, construction joints, tie-ins between various building envelope components, and workmanship.
We reviewed the site mock-ups of specific and critical building envelope details and worked closely with the contractor and sub-contractor regarding the constructability of the critical details. We also provided roofing system site reviews during construction, paying special attention to the detailing of the parapets, construction joints, tie-ins between various roofing components and the building envelope, and workmanship.
Lastly, we provided foundation waterproofing and damp proofing reviews during construction. Attention was paid to the detailing around penetrations, laps and joints.
